Joost is a grooving funky, but also romantic soul. Selfmade, one-man's band, I've composed about 1000 songs so far..and counting. Used to play and record everything myself, but with modern technology that all changed and now I use real organic loops manipulate them and combine that with jazzy playing, a touch of improvisation and bluesy raspy cockerish blue-eyed soul singing. I've been inspired by many great artists who are mostly eclectic in styles, like Gino Vannelli, Todd Rundgren, Miles Davis, Boz Scaggs, John Martyn, Sting, Terry Callier. I thank them all!! Mostly influenced by the 1960-70's, but I keep a sharp eye on today's fashions. At first I started out as a drummer and played with a lot of bands in Holland. I found out that I could write songs too and ended up as a singer and did a lot of crazy stuff on stage to wake up the crowd. Now I record and write a lot and sometimes I miss playing these songs with a grooving band, but on the other hand I feel very comfortable doing it all by myself. Trying to make my own mark on music.
